About The Board
95.5 KHFM emerged as a public, listener-supported station in September 2017, after more than 60 years as a commercial classical music station. In accordance with the station’s new bylaws, the Community Advisory Board (CAB) was established in Spring of 2019 to advise the governing body of the station on whether its programming and other policies are meeting the specialized educational and cultural needs of the communities served by the station, and make recommendations as it considers appropriate to meet such needs. To that end, the CAB’s activities are organized into four focus areas: programming, community outreach, financial sustainability, and review of significant policy decisions.
CAB members are drawn from music and arts organizations in the listening area, as well as individuals in the community with special skills and relevant experience. For more information, contact cab@khfm.org.
